[請益] Mysql排序

看板PHP作者 (Shuk)時間19年前 (2007/02/28 23:49), 編輯推噓7(702)
留言9則, 5人參與, 最新討論串1/1
小弟我只是用類似留言版的方法 用填寫表單在送出到資料庫作寫入 在用網頁顯示出來 也知道如何從最後一比開始顯示資料 可是............ 我故意寫入10次 他排的順序卻不一樣 為什麼呢@@? ex: 第幾次 排序 1 9 2 10 3 8 4 7 5 6 6 5 7 4 8 3 9 2 10 1 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 61.231.203.199

03/01 01:26, , 1F
01 02 03 04 05 06 07 08 09 10 .....XD
03/01 01:26, 1F

03/01 02:38, , 2F
order by (cast id as unsigned) 囧
03/01 02:38, 2F

03/01 19:40, , 3F
order by abs(column_name)
03/01 19:40, 3F

03/02 19:26, , 4F
樓上講的應該是取出的時候吧?
03/02 19:26, 4F

03/02 19:28, , 5F
可是我是寫入後去資料庫看的排序
03/02 19:28, 5F

03/02 19:28, , 6F
所以是資料庫排序的問題
03/02 19:28, 6F

03/02 19:28, , 7F
除了一樓外 沒有讓他寫入時資料庫就會排序正常的方法?
03/02 19:28, 7F

03/05 01:21, , 8F
取出來 用php 塞到array慢排
03/05 01:21, 8F

03/07 16:18, , 9F
database受限越多...你困擾會越大呦...
03/07 16:18, 9F
文章代碼(AID): #15vQIIIT (PHP)
文章代碼(AID): #15vQIIIT (PHP)